ZANDAR was an entrepreneurial startup at the dawn of the PC Era founded by its President, Harry Summerfield, PhD. The head engineer for the past decade is Brian Knittel, a fully qualified software design engineer and graduate of the University of California, Berkeley, School of Electrical Engineering and Computer Science and author of several best selling books on the Microsoft Windows operating system.

ZANDAR Corporation began development on its core TagWrite software technology in 1987 following from a consulting contract with the U. S. Navy on the "paperless ship", ways to reduce the weight of technical manuals on-board ships. ZANDAR was substantially launched when Xerox licensed parts of the technology in 1988. Pieces of TagWrite technology have in the past also been licensed to Aldus Corporation, Corel of Canada, and GE. Our core technology is extensive and development continues on custom and retail applications with products marketed under the registered trademark TagWrite™.

TagWrite is distinguished not only for its precision but also because the entire conversion is performed in computer memory. TagWrite "parses" (reads) the original data and passes through all data without the risk of human corruption. We do NOT scan or re-key. The integrity of your data is protected. This results in substantial savings because most customers do not find a need to bear the huge cost to proofread the converted document for content.

Custom Products

We have built on-demand MS Word to XML converters for well structured Word documents.

We have built Microsoft Word formatters for XML/SGML. For example, for a number of years we provided Boeing Commercial Airplane customers worldwide the TagWrite Boeing Service Bulletin Transformer to transform airplane service bulletins from Air Transport Authority standard SGML to Microsoft Word with tables and graphics in place. The end user needed to do nothing more than access normal Microsoft Word menus.

The TagWrite Ventura<>RTF Transformer is a point and click Wizard setup. The Import into Ventura portion of the Transformer was licensed by Corel, owner of Ventura, and was included in some versions of the Ventura retail box. The export transformer that lets you get out of Ventura and into RTF is available only from ZANDAR.
